Hunting game birds
Hunting game birds can be fun as well as challenging. Before you go hunting, here are tips for safety:
• Every shotgun must be treated as though it is loaded all times and carefully handled.
• The safety should be kept on up until immediately before you take a shot.
• Keep your shooting finger away from the trigger, resting it behind the trigger guard.
• Be very sure of your target and when in doubt, do not shoot; be mindful of the position of blockers as well as walkers.
• Never attempt shooting at “low flying” birds.
• Be familiar with your gun’s range.
• Wear a neon orange cap or vest so that other hunters can see you from a far distance.
